Introduction
We are very pleased to present our first Orthopaedic Conference, Hot Topics in Musculoskeletal & Sports Medicine. This conference is designed to update you on the latest diagnostic and treatment strategies for patients with sports and musculoskeletal aliments and injuries. The program is case oriented and will utilize didactic lectures, and live instruction in examination techniques and joint anatomy creating an interactive and dynamic learning format. At this event you will be brought up to date on the most current developments in a wide number of areas of Orthopaedic, Sports and MSK/ Rehabilitation Medicine
Objectives
- To discuss and resolve some of your MSK/ Sports and Orthopedic related problem cases with experts and colleagues
- Identify techniques for non-surgical management of osteoarthritis of the knee and hip and review total hip and knee replacement updates
- Diagnosis and treat common tendonopathies
- Perform a physical examination of the foot and ankle and identify appropriate joint injections techniques
- Recognize the top 5 MSK diagnosis and back pain red flags not to miss
- Evaluate and appropriately treat shoulder pain
Credits
This program meets the accreditation criteria of The College of Family Physicians of Canada and has been accredited by the British Columbia Chapter for up to 6 Mainpro-M1 credits.
This event is an Accredited Group Learning Activity (Section 1) as defined by the Maintenance of Certification program of the Royal College of Physicians and Surgeons of Canada. This program has been reviewed and approved by UBC Division of Continuing Professional Development.
